WebMar 25, 2024 · Put the chicken back over the beer. Using a pastry brush, paint the chicken with the rub you made earlier. Roast at 350℉ / 176℃ for about 90 minutes or until the thickest part of the thigh reads 165℉ / 73℃ on an instant-read thermometer. WebJul 16, 2024 · In the Oven. Preheat the oven to 375°F with a rack in the lower ⅓ of the oven. In a small bowl, combine the salt, brown sugar, paprika, pepper, and garlic powder. Season the chicken inside and out with the spice blend. Pour out (or drink) half of the beer and secure the chicken cavity over the beer can, pressing down until only 2-inches of ...
